La zone Agew Awi est l'une des 10 zones de la région Amhara en Éthiopie. Son centre administratif est Enjebara



Woredas |


La zone est composée de 5 woredas:


  • Ankesha

  • Banja

  • Dangila

  • Guangua

  • Faggeta Lekoma


Villes |



  • Chagni
